#8fccda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8fccda is composed of 56.1% red, 80%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.4% cyan, 6.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 191.2 degrees, a saturation of 50.3% and a lightness of 70.8%. #8fccda color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1f99b5.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#8fccda

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020506 is the darkest color, while #f6fb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#8fccda

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b1b6b8 is the less saturated color, while #6de2fc is the most saturated one.
